East Hampshire District Council

East Hampshire District Council is a UK public-sector contracting authority. This profile aggregates its public-record procurement — top suppliers, categories, recent awards, open tenders and expiring contracts.

Data period: 2023-06-17 to 2026-06-17Updated 2026-06-17

£14.0M

Total spend

132

Contract awards

100

Unique suppliers

£108K

Avg contract

According to ENKII, East Hampshire District Council has awarded 132 contracts worth £14.0M to 100 suppliers between 2023-06-17 and 2026-06-17, at an average contract value of £108K, with the top five suppliers holding 25% of contract value.

Frequently asked

Common questions about selling to East Hampshire District Council

How much does East Hampshire District Council spend on procurement?

East Hampshire District Council awarded 132 contracts totalling £14.0M between 2023-06-17 and 2026-06-17, working with 100 unique suppliers. Average contract value is £108K.

Who are East Hampshire District Council's top suppliers?

The largest suppliers to East Hampshire District Council by total award value are FOREMOST TREE SURGEONS LIMITED, Idox Software LTD,, Risual Ltd. The top five suppliers together hold 25% of contract value.

What does East Hampshire District Council buy from suppliers?

East Hampshire District Council's procurement is concentrated in 71310000, 72260000, 79620000, alongside specialist categories. See the full CPV breakdown below.

What's the typical response window for East Hampshire District Council tenders?

East Hampshire District Council typically gives suppliers a median of 21 days to respond (average 25 days). Standard contract duration is around 17 months.
